Introduction
WAGNER is a well-established company with 75 years of operating experience. With over 2000 employees worldwide, the WAGNER Group is a world leading manufacturer and supplier of high technology surface finishing products and systems. Users of our efficient, reliable, and cost-effective solutions include final consumers, contractors, and industrial manufacturing companies. The company operates as two divisions, Decorative Finishing (DF) and Industrial Solutions (IS).
